在今天的互联网时代,安全问题成为了每个人都需要关注的问题。对于一家网站来说,保证服务器的稳定性和安全性显得尤为重要。而在这方面,Linux服务器监控则是一项不可或缺的工作。本文将从8个方面详细介绍Linux服务器监控相关知识,帮助读者更好地了解和掌握这项技术。
1.监控指标
首先,我们需要了解哪些指标需要被监控。常见的指标包括CPU使用率、内存使用率、磁盘空间使用率、网络流量等。通过对这些指标进行监控,可以及时发现服务器出现异常情况,并采取相应的措施。
2.监控工具
接下来,我们需要选择合适的监控工具。目前市面上有很多开源的监控工具,例如Zabbix、Nagios、Cacti等。这些工具都有各自的特点和优缺点,需要根据实际情况进行选择。
3.监控方式
除了常规的轮询式监控方式外,还有基于事件和流式数据的监控方式。基于事件的监控方式可以及时发现异常事件并采取相应的处理措施;而基于流式数据的监控方式则可以实时地对数据进行分析和处理。
4.数据存储
通过监控工具获取到的数据需要被存储起来以备后续分析和查询。常见的数据存储方式包括MySQL、InfluxDB等。在选择数据存储方式时需要考虑到数据量、查询速度等因素。
5.数据可视化
为了更加直观地了解服务器状态,我们需要将监控数据进行可视化展示。Grafana是一个非常好用的可视化工具,它支持多种数据源,并且提供了丰富的图表展示功能。
6.告警设置
当服务器出现异常情况时linux 服务器监控,我们需要及时地得到通知并采取相应的处理措施。通过设置告警规则可以实现自动通知管理员或相关人员。
7.日志分析
日志分析是另一个重要的方面。通过分析日志可以发现服务器存在哪些潜在问题linux系统安装,并及时采取相应的处理措施。常见的日志分析工具包括ELK Stack等。
8.安全加固
最后一个方面是安全加固。通过对服务器进行加固操作可以有效地防止黑客攻击和恶意软件入侵。在加固过程中需要注意保证服务正常运行,并且不影响用户体验。
总结:
本文从8个方面详细介绍了Linux服务器监控相关知识。通过对这些知识点进行学习和实践,可以帮助我们更好地保障网站安全性和稳定性linux 服务器监控linux rar,让用户享受到更好的服务体验。